HeapSortをやってみます。これはちょっとわかりにくいですです。いろいろ調べてみましょう。 まず、ヒープって何?ということです。ヒープ構造というのは ヒープ : データ構造ヒープは半順序集合をベースとするツリー構造です。www.codereading.com ヒープは半 ...
この記事の要約:ヒープソートの最初の出力が何になるか?heapifyの動作と配列の構造を追いながら、Javaで実装しながらやさしく解説します。 ヒープは完全二分木をベースに、親 ≥ 子の関係(最大ヒープ)を守る構造です。 heapify(n, i) は、ノード i を根 ...
アルゴリズムをプログラムで表示した場合、アルゴリズムの概念自体が複雑な上に抽象的なコードのせいもあって、実行されるアルゴリズムのプログラムをイメージするのは難しいものです。そんな抽象的なアルゴリズムのプログラム学習には、コードだけ ...
一部の結果でアクセス不可の可能性があるため、非表示になっています。
アクセス不可の結果を表示する